bruinen, Acantopsis Boyd [D. A.], So [N.], Thach [P.] & Page [L. M.] 2018:[3], Figs. 1, 2a [Ichthyological Exploration of Freshwaters v. 29 (no. 1) IEF-1096; ref. 36347] Tonle Kong River 10 km upstream of confluence with Mekong River, Stung Treng, Cambodia, 13°36'34"N, 106°05'32"E. Holotype: UF 190188. Paratypes: IFREDI, THNHM, UF. Plus additional non-type material. •Valid as Acantopsis bruinen Boyd, So, Thach & Page 2018 -- (Taki et al. 2021:192 [ref. 39830]). Current status: Valid as Acantopsis bruinen Boyd, So, Thach & Page 2018. Cobitidae. Distribution: Southeast Asia: Mekong, Mae Khlong and Tapi River basins, Thailand, Laos and Cambodia. Habitat: freshwater.
